About Austco

Austco is a global manufacturer of hospital and clinical communications hardware and software. We make innovative products that help nurses and caregivers as they care for their patients. Established in Perth, Australia in 1986, Austco builds the most advanced nurse call and clinical communications technology in the world.

Austco's corporate head office is located in Melbourne, Australia. Our international offices are located in the USA, Canada, the UK, Singapore and New Zealand. The R&D and Order Fulfillment business units are based in Dallas, Texas.
